This was my first concert with Seether and I really enjoyed it. The Huxleys in Berlin is a very cool location. An old theater with much space to mosh and jump.

The opening act with Sons Of Texas was absolutely awesome. Combining metal and the slap bass was just pleasing my ears. Great songs and the power of the band was an amazing opener.

The second opening act didn't even introduced themselves. They were not bad, but after Sons Of Texas their style was more chilly than metal. Kind of a bummer when you we're heated uo by a nice slap bass and frenzy riffs. The effect-tool they used was in one song way to much. The sound technician should have catched that and ease out some highs. They also played metal, but later. It was still good.

Seether was great act. I love the band and their songs. Singing at the top of my lungs and having little left of my voice afterwards, isn't worth mentioning. Seether played some great tracks. The new stuff, classics and was rocking the hall. Even though they hadn't played Careless Whisper, but Broken was stunning. The singer Made a lot pauses between the songs, talking to someone and drinking stuff. That time added up would have been two extra songs. Also the sound technician was probably dozing or staring at girl in the crowd, but he modulated it a bit too much. Also he failed the mics sometimes. You couldn't hear the singer or just barely. Nevertheless, I would go again!

Multi-platinum rock band, Staind has announced The Tailgate Tour with long-time friends, Seether and featuring Saint Asonia and Tim Montana, beginning April 22, 2024 in Brandon, Mississippi.

Produced by Live Nation, The Tailgate Tour reunites Staind and Seether for the first time in years. “I’m really looking forward to being back on the road with my good friends Seether, Tim Montana and Saint Asonia,” says lead vocalist Aaron Lewis. “It’s going to be a great time.”

The eleven-date trek begins April 22, 2024 with dates across the US, including Franklin, TN, Portland, ME and Grand Rapids, MI before wrapping up in Pelham, AL May 15.

Tickets will be available starting with Artist presales beginning Wednesday, November 15 @ 10:00am local time. Additional presales will run throughout the week ahead of the general public onsale beginning Friday, November 17 @ 12pm local time at staindofficial.com

See full tour itinerary below.

Staind recently released their first studio album in twelve years, Confessions of the Fallen to rave reviews. The band’s latest single, “ Here & Now” and powerful video has just entered Top 5 on the active rock chart, the second Top 5 single from the new album.

About Staind

STAIND is comprised of lead vocalist and rhythm guitarist Aaron Lewis, lead guitarist Mike Mushok, bassist and backing vocalist Johnny April, and drummer Sal Giancarelli. The band was formed in 1995 in their hometown of Springfield, Massachusetts. Over the course of their career, the band has released seven studio albums and eight Top 10 singles, selling over 15 million albums worldwide.  Break The Cycle , released in 2001 and RIAA certified 5x platinum, featured the smash single, “It’s Been Awhile,” one of the most played songs in modern rock radio history, spending 20 weeks at Number 1. In 2019 after a five-year hiatus, STAIND reunited for some unforgettable festival performances, and a hometown reunion show that was recorded for the live album, Live: It’s Been Awhile. STAIND will release their new studio album, their first in twelve years, Confessions of the Fallen in September 2023.

Next, Staind and Seether are mounting a co-headlining tour across the United States. Very special guests for the trek will be Saint Asonia. The run will see guitarist Mike Mushok pulling double duty, as he will open the shows performing with Saint Asonia, and closing them out with Staind. The Tailgate Tour kicks off on April 22 at the Brandon Amphitheater in Brandon, Missouri and wraps up on May 15 at the Oak Mountain Amphitheatre in Pelham, Alabama. The tour includes stops at North Charleston Coliseum, Bon Secours Wellness Arena, and Santander Arena, among others. Tim Montana will open all shows.

See the full tour itinerary below now. Venue pre-sales begin Thursday, November 16 at 10am local time. Tickets go on sale this Friday, November 17 at 12pm local time.

Since 1999, Staind and Seether have been consistent forces in rock music. Together, both bands combine for nine No. 1 hits on Billboard’s Mainstream Rock Airplay chart, and have dominated rock radio for two decades. Several of these hits crossed over to pop radio, and charted on the Billboard Hot 100. From 2001 to 2005, Staind released three albums that all hit No. 1 on the Billboard 200. Beginning with 2005’s Karma and Effect , Seether released four straight albums that all debuted in the Top 10 on the Billboard 200.

Staind Mike Mushok live

Staind are touring in support of their new album, Confessions of the Fallen . The record arrived back on September 22, and it is their first release through their new label, BMG. The long awaited follow-up to the band’s 2011 self-titled LP, Confessions of the Fallen debuted at No. 4 on Billboard’s Top Album Sales chart. A pair of singles made their way onto Billboard’s Mainstream Rock Airplay chart – “Here and Now” and “Lowest in Me,” the latter of which gave Staind their first No. 1 hit since their 2011 song, “Not Again.”

The group recently wrapped up a North American amphitheater run alongside Godsmack.

Seether released their eighth studio album, Si Vis Pacem, Para Bellum (If You Want Peace, Prepare for War), back in 2020. Producing three singles, the album cracked the Top 50 on the Billboard 200. All three singles from the record – “Dangerous,” “Bruised and Bloodied,” and “Wasteland” – topped Billboard’s Mainstream Rock Airplay chart. The record was produced by frontman Shaun Morgan.

Saint Asonia recently revealed a new version of their song “Wolf” with a guest appearance from Skillet’s John Cooper. The track is from their 2022 EP,  Extrovert  (Spinefarm). The six-song outing is a companion to their 2018 EP,  Introvert . On December 9, the band will released both EPs in a physical package called  Introvert/Extrovert . The physical recording contains bonus tracks as well.

STAIND Announces 'The Tailgate Tour' With SEETHER And SAINT ASONIA

Multi-platinum rock band STAIND has announced "The Tailgate Tour" with longtime friends SEETHER and featuring SAINT ASONIA and Tim Montana , beginning April 22, 2024 in Brandon, Mississippi.

Produced by Live Nation , "The Tailgate Tour" reunites STAIND and SEETHER for the first time in years.

"I'm really looking forward to being back on the road with my good friends SEETHER , Tim Montana and SAINT ASONIA ," says STAIND lead vocalist Aaron Lewis . "It's going to be a great time."

The 11-date trek begins April 22, 2024 with dates across the U.S., including Franklin, Tennessee; Portland, Maine and Grand Rapids, Michigan, before wrapping up in Pelham, Alabama on May 15.

Tickets will be available starting with artist presales beginning Wednesday, November 15 at 10:00 a.m. local time. Additional presales will run throughout the week ahead of the general public onsale beginning Friday, November 17 at 12 p.m. (noon) local time at staindofficial.com .

STAIND 's latest album, "Confessions Of The Fallen" , arrived on September 15 via Alchemy Recordings / BMG . STAIND 's first new LP album since 2011 was produced by Erik Ron ( GODSMACK , PANIC! AT THE DISCO , BLACK VEIL BRIDES ).

When "Confessions Of The Fallen" was announced in April, STAIND frontman Aaron Lewis stated about the LP's musical direction: "I did want to modernize the sound and bring us up to date. You can certainly recognize the band but at the same time you can hear that we've been paying attention and understand what kind of sounds and approaches we can use that maybe weren't around the last time we did this."

STAIND has released eight albums since 1995, including 2011's self-titled effort. The band has had a number of hit songs during its first two decades, including the Top 10 smash "It's Been Awhile" from the No. 1 album "Break The Cycle" . Follow-up LPs "14 Shades Of Grey" and "Chapter V" also topped the Billboard chart.

STAIND released its first album in nine years, "Live: It's Been Awhile" , in May 2021 via Yap'em / Alchemy Recordings . The "Live: It's Been Awhile" album was accompanied by "The Return Of Staind" , a two-part global streaming series in partnership with Danny Wimmer Presents .

STAIND and GODSMACK recently completed a 25-city co-headlining 2023 tour, produced by Live Nation .

About seether.

Seether is a South African rock band founded in May 1999 in Pretoria, Gauteng, South Africa. The band originally performed under the name Saron Gas until 2002, when they moved to the United States and changed it to Seether. Disclaimer is their original album and major label debut. They gained mainstream popularity in 2002 with their US Active Rock number one single "Fine Again", and their success was sustained in 2004 with the single "Broken" which peaked at number 20 on the Billboard Hot 100. They have experienced continued success with number one hits on the Hot Mainstream Rock Tracks chart such as "Remedy", "Fake It", "Country Song", "Words as Weapons" and "Let You Down". The band currently consists of lead vocalist/rhythm guitarist Shaun Morgan, bassist Dale Stewart, drummer John Humphrey, and touring guitarist Clint Lowery. Seether has undergone several lineup changes since their formation in 1999, with vocalist/guitarist Shaun Morgan remaining constant.

Craft Recordings has partnered with Seether to celebrate the 20th anniversary of their Gold-selling debut, Disclaimer , with an expanded reissue on vinyl, CD, and digital editions.

Set for release on January 20, 2023 and available for pre-order today, the deluxe 3-LP or 2-CD set includes the original 12-track album (featuring such enduring hits as “Gasoline,” “Fine Again,” and “Driven Under”) plus a previously unreleased live show, captured in its entirety at New Hampshire’s Hampton Beach Casino in 2003. Rounding out the bonus content on Disclaimer (Deluxe Edition) is a rare 2002 live acoustic cover of Nirvana’s “Something in the Way,” which was first issued as a B-side.

The 3-LP edition is housed in a deluxe triple gatefold jacket, while both physical formats also include new liner notes from Katherine Turman, an acclaimed music journalist, producer, and co-author of Louder Than Hell: The Definitive Oral History of Metal .

Formed in Pretoria, South Africa, in 1999, Seether (originally named Saron Gas) instantly hooked fans at home with their blend of alt-metal, grunge, and heart-on-sleeve lyricism. At the turn of the millennium, not long after releasing the South Africa-only Fragile , the band (originally consisting of vocalist and guitarist Shaun Morgan, bassist Dale Stewart and drummer Dave Cohoe) caught the ears of Wind-Up Records, who brought the trio to the US to record their international debut.

In the whirlwind weeks between pre-production in New York City and recording in Los Angeles, the band gained a new name (borrowing their permanent moniker from Veruca Salt’s 1994 alt-rock hit) and lost a drummer, when Cohoe chose to return home. As the band auditioned new drummers, veteran musician Josh Freese (The Vandals, A Perfect Circle, Nine Inch Nails) stepped in to lend his talents in the studio.

Over the next four months, Seether recorded new material, plus seven selects from Fragile , with producer Jay Baumgardner (Bush, Shinedown, Papa Roach). Several songs dated back to Morgan’s teenage years, including the brooding “Fine Again,” written after his parent’s divorce. “69 Tea,” meanwhile, was one of Morgan’s earliest compositions as well as the band’s first single in South Africa.

Staind Announces Arena Tour with Seether, I Prevail 

The rockers of Staind are hitting the road next year for a brief radio arena tour with a stacked lineup.

The eight-date tour kicks-off at Planet Band Camp at St. Augustine Amphitheatre in Florida on April 18, followed by Amalie Arena’s 98 Rockfest in Tampa, WJRR’s Earthday Birthday at Central Florida Fairgrounds in Orlando, WDHA’s Rock the Rock Fest at the Prudential Center in Newark, and the 98 Rock Spring Thing at CFG Bank Arena in Baltimore.

They’ll also appear at The Big Gig at DCU Center in Worcester and 102.9 HOG FEST at the Fiserv Forum in Milwaukee before wrapping-up at the 93X Twin City Takeover at Xcel Energy Center in St. Paul on May 4.

Buy Sell and Go with confidence at StubHub

Throughout the run, various bands will provide support, varying per date, including the metalcore groups I Prevail, Asking Alexandria, Dayseeker, and Sleep Theory, the heavy-rockers of Seether, and the ’70s-style glam rockers of The Struts. Grunge-rock’s Aryon Jones, country’s Tim Montana, rock artist Austin Meade, and the all-female rocker group Plush will round out the bill at select shows.

Staind released their eighth studio album, Confessions of the Fallen, in September. This marks the band’s first studio record since 2011’s self-titled. This time around, frontman Aaron Lewis told Blabbermouth that he wanted to “modernize the sound and bring us up to date.”

“You can certainly recognize the band but at the same time you can hear that we’ve been paying attention and understand what kind of sounds and approaches we can use that maybe weren’t around the last time we did this,” Lewis said.

Staind first arrived on the scene in 1995, garnering attention in the early 2000s with hits like “It’s Been Awhile,” “So Far Away,” and “Everything Changes.”

Maren Morris announces 'RSVP Redux' tour

March 21 (UPI) -- Maren Morris is going on tour in 2024.

The 33-year-old singer-songwriter announced the RSVP Redux tour on Thursday.

Morris was originally to launch the RSVP tour in 2020 but canceled due to the COVID-19 pandemic.

The tour will now begin May 29 in San Francisco and run through July 31 in Sandpoint, Idaho. Morris said there are "more dates to come."

Betty Who will join as a special guest on select dates.

Tickets go on sale March 29 at 10 a.m. local time, with pre-sales to begin March 26 at 10 a.m.

"the tour that never was, gets a 2024 redux. playing the fan club shows last year made me realize how much I missed the intimate venues and having fun dusting off some deep cuts. I didn't want to stop, so we are carrying the spirit of those shows to slightly bigger rooms where more people can join us," Morris wrote on Instagram.

Morris released the EP The Bridge in September 2023 after announcing she was leaving the world of country music.
